ABOUT THIS GAME
Defend Your Base in Mellings
In Mellings, a 3D shooting game on PC, players command a fixed turret amidst the chaos of a battlefield. The objective is clear: defend yourself while unleashing firepower against waves of enemies. Utilize strategy as you aim and adjust your shots, all while balancing parameters for risk and reward. Create a compelling experience that caters to your tactical preferences.
Mission-Driven Gameplay with Expedition Elements
Launching expeditions is at the heart of Mellings. Players can customize missions by selecting various parameters that influence their gameplay style. Each decision impacts the risk involved and the potential rewards for your subterranean community. As you embark on these undertakings, the thrill of preparing for each mission keeps players engaged, adding depth to every excursion.
Rebuilding the City of the Mellings
Your overarching goal involves reconstructing a city for the Mellings, a mysterious race imprisoned across various locations in the world. To achieve this, players scour different regions for resources and survivors. The encounters are not only about combat; they center on survival and strategy as you balance your city’s needs against external threats and critical mission objectives.
